Understand the Court Process



Navigating a dui court hearing can feel complicated, yet recognizing the court process can make it much more workable. Initially, you'll need to know that your hearing is most likely to occur in a municipal or region court. You'll enter the court room, where the judge presides over your case in addition to the district attorney and possibly your lawyer. It is very important to show up very early to familiarize on your own with the setup and the treatments.

Next, the hearing normally begins with the court calling your situation. You'll be asked to enter a plea-- guilty, not guilty, or no competition. If you beg innocent, the court will certainly arrange a test day. During the hearing, both sides may present evidence, witness testaments, and arguments. Be prepared to pay attention carefully and respond properly.

Comprehending court etiquette is critical; stand when the court enters and departures, and speak only when motivated. Stay calm and made up, as this can impact how the judge regards you.

Gather Necessary Documents



Gathering necessary papers is necessary for your DWI court hearing. Beginning by collecting all appropriate documents pertaining to your instance. This includes your arrest report, citation, and any type of breath or blood test results. These documents supply key details that can affect your protection and will certainly aid you understand the specifics of the fees versus you.

Next off, collect any kind of evidence that supports your instance. This may consist of witness declarations, pictures, or any other documentation that can help establish your side of the story. If you have actually finished any alcohol education and learning programs, consist of those certifications also; they can show the court your commitment to resolving the problem.

Consult With Legal Professionals



Consulting with attorneys is a vital action in planning for your DWI court hearing. A knowledgeable attorney can offer you with invaluable insights into the legal process, helping you understand the charges against you and potential defenses.

They'll evaluate your instance's specifics, including the conditions of your arrest and any kind of evidence accumulated, to formulate a strong technique. You ought to select a legal representative that specializes in drunk driving situations, as they'll be familiar with regional legislations and court treatments.
